cross browser

Below Are my script functions for dropdowns associated with whether you answer yes or no to the questions. The problem is they only work in ie. I need them to work on all browsers, netscape and firefox. Is there something wrong in my script. I’m at a loss. All help welcomed…

<script type=”text/javascript”>
document.onload = function w00p() {document.getElementById(“hide1″).style.display=”list-item”;}
</script>
<script type=”text/javascript”>
document.onload = function w00t() {document.getElementById(“hide2″).style.display=”list-item”;}
</script>
<script type=”text/javascript”>
document.onload = function w00ts() {document.getElementById(“hide3″).style.display=”list-item”;}
</script>

@FangFeb 24.2005 — Use one [I]onload[/I] function with the other functions called from there.
